Relay for Life Looks for Volunteer Teams

Organizers for the Holliston/Ashland relay for life are looking for walkers for the June 9 event.

Teams from Ashland and Holliston will begin an around the clock relay at Ashland Middle School at noon on June 9 to raise support for cancer research. 

"Many of the participants are cancer survivors, which serves as a reminder that our community is not immune to this disease and that by participating in Relay, we are joining with the American Cancer Society’s efforts to create a world with less cancer and more birthdays,” Denise Landry-Horowitz, an organizer of the Ashland/Holliston Relay for Life, said in a press release.

Relay for Life's coordinators are currently searching for teams to volunteer to participate in the event and fund-raise in the weeks leading up to the relay.

Funds raised from the event will benefit the American Cancer Society and will provide support for cancer research.
